From: XXXX Sent: December-28-13 4:28 PM To: Consumer Code / Code consommateur Subject: prepaid XXXX I recently purchased a prepaid XXXX gift card for $35.00. The purchase was made at XXXX and the issuing institution is XXXX out of XXXX. On further examination I realized that there is a $4.50 "activation fee" plus a 2.5% fee if used in the United States. The XXXX card should be considered "cash". The activation fee is simply theft. Charging a fee of 12.86% of the total value to access the cash is outrageous. If you further consider that XXXX collects a fee from the merchant when the gift card is used, the benefit to XXXX is totally excessive in relation to any value to the consumer. XXXX
